2 SAFETY

2.1 General instructions

Read this user manual carefully before performing any operation
on the Sf16 sound system;
Keep this user manual in a safe and readily reachable place for
consultation. The user manual is part and parcel to the product and
must be kept with the product in the case of transfer of the device;
Observe the installation conditions in this manual to allow safe and
effi cient use of the product (see Section 9 "Technical Data");
Do not install the device in these conditions:
Near sources of heat or naked fl ames;
In places exposed to great humidity or splashes of liquids of
any type;
Outdoors, exposed to bad weather or direct sunlight;
Placed on unstable furniture or stands which, if knocked
against by people or animals, can make the device fall.

3 DESCRIPTION AND CHARACTERISTICS

The Sf16 sound system is able to play music in different formats by using a Wi-Fi network connection (through the DTS Play-Fi® system) or the connection
of digital or analogue audio sources. It features an amplifi cation system with 4 channels, 350 W each, and 3 groups of speakers that form a 3-way system.
The incorporated "Sound Field Shaper" system manages the rear speakers and the adjustable front satellites speakers for medium-high frequencies, providing
improved spatiality and amplitude of the soundstage.

Do not put the device on containers holding liquids or naked
fl ames (candles or other);
Do not install the device in such a way that the power cord or other
connection cables are not too taut, walked on or can cause the
tripping of people or animals;
Do not let children play or tamper with the device;
Connect the power cord only to sockets provided with connection
to an effi cient earthing system;
Disconnect the power cord from the mains socket during lightning
storms and in the event that the device is not used for extended
periods of time;
Do not try to open the device or repair it and do not remove the
cover panels.
